Function: resolveResqCookieDomain()
resolveResqCookieDomain(Defined in: resq.ts:97 Resolve the production ResQ cookie domain only when the current host actually lives underhost?):string|undefined
resq.software.
Cloudflare/Vercel preview URLs and localhost would otherwise have
their cookie rejected by the browser with a domain mismatch, silently
breaking analytics in every non-prod environment. This guards that
path so the package can ship safe defaults.
Hostnames are case-insensitive per RFC 3986 §3.2.2. Browsers normalize
window.location.hostname to lowercase, but server-side reads of the
Host header can carry whatever casing the client sent — normalize
here so a stray RESQ.SOFTWARE from a Workers request.headers read
still returns the cookie domain.
Parameters
host?
string | null
The current hostname. In a browser, pass
window.location.hostname. On the server pass the Host header
value, or null / undefined (or call without an argument) to
short-circuit cleanly.
Returns
string | undefined
".resq.software" when host belongs to that registrable
root, otherwise undefined — assign the result directly to
AnalyticsConfig.cookieDomain.
